Camas High School team shows winning knowledge at bowl

The Columbian
Published: April 2, 2013, 5:00pm

Camas — For the second time in its history, Camas High School sent two Knowledge Bowl teams to the 31st annual Washington State Knowledge Bowl Tournament on March 23. The team known as “Camas No. 2 Varsity” came out the grand champion. Team members included Tim Grote, Marcus Bintz (captain), Griffin King and Noah Wachlin. Other local teams that did well came from Union High, Mt. View, Columbia River and La Center. A total of 216 teams from across the state competed at various levels.
